Awesome Donkey:
They run in the background until the task(s) are complete, which it seems they have a while yet until completion. You *can* disable both via the configure auto-import dialog unless you can live with it until it's done (IMO, I'd leave it enabled and let it do its thing - especially if you're interested in using volume leveling).
